Dil Hum To Haare lyrics, the song is sung by Geeta Ghosh Roy Chowdhuri (Geeta Dutt), Mohammed Rafi from Ardhangini (1959). The music of Dil Hum To Haare Dance track is composed by Vasant Desai while the lyrics are penned by Majrooh Sultanpuri.
